@techreport{martinsen-tram-stuntrace-01, number = {draft-martinsen-tram-stuntrace-01}, type = {Internet-Draft}, institution = {Internet Engineering Task Force}, publisher = {Internet Engineering Task Force}, note = {Work in Progress}, url = {https://datatracker.ietf.org/doc/draft-martinsen-tram-stuntrace/01/}, author = {Paal-Erik Martinsen and Dan Wing}, title = {{STUN Traceroute}}, pagetotal = 11, year = 2015, month = jun, day = 1, abstract = {After a UDP protocol such as RTP determines a network path is experiencing problems, a traceroute is often useful to determine which router or which link is contributing to the problem. However, operating system traceroute commands follow a different path than the actual UDP flow which complicates troubleshooting. A superior method is shown which is absolutely path-congruent with the UDP protocol itself, works on IPv4 and IPv6, and does not require administrative privileges on most operating systems.}, }
